A Seattle photographer asks Mark Hamill for his thoughts on #snowpocalypse2019.

On Saturday, Seattle photographer Lindsey Wasson took to Saturday to talk snow.

"Great, @NWSSeattle is forecasting more #SeattleSnowMageddon2019 and I'm all out of tauntauns," she wrote. Then she mentioned Mark Hamill, who plays Luke Skywalker in the Star Wars movies. "Any tips, @HamillHimself?"

(Tauntaun = two-legged snow creature on Hoth in "Empire Strikes Back.")

Hamill replied! "Stay indoors until summer."

A flurry of responses followed (maybe Hamill would respond again!).

Our favorite, because we are suckers for puns: "One could say it's becoming a Hoth-stile environment."
